Systems And Methods For Vehicle Fleet Sharing

US Patent:
2015029, Oct 15, 2015
Filed:
Apr 14, 2015
Appl. No.:
14/686219
Inventors:
- Boston MA, US
David Lambert - Boston MA, US
Dylan Spencer - Medford MA, US
Chris Wheeler - Cambridge MA, US
Griffin Mahoney - Cambridge MA, US
Russen Guggemos - Medford MA, US
James Martineau - Somerville MA, US
Guido Bartoloni - Boston MA, US
Miles Hoffman - Cambridge MA, US
Chris Chu - Boston MA, US
Alex Moore-Niemi - Cambridge MA, US
Lesley Mottla - Rockport MA, US
Al Seely - Burlington MA, US
Scott Rudberg - Newton MA, US
International Classification:
G06Q 30/06
Abstract:
The disclosed technology relates generally to methods and systems for sharing vehicles between fleets. Vehicle sharing services typically experience the most use during the weekend. Thus, many vehicles used by vehicle sharing services sit idle during the week. Meanwhile, vehicle rental companies experience the most demand during the week and their vehicles are underutilized during the week. The disclosed technology, in certain embodiments, provides systems and methods for sharing vehicles between a vehicle sharing entity and a vehicle renting entity. This allows the entities to lower fleet costs and obtain better fleet utilization by moving vehicles between fleets when one entity anticipates a spike in demand. For example, the ability for the vehicle sharing service to utilize a rental vehicle agency's excess weekend inventory will allow them to meet its strong weekend demand without the need for purchasing and maintaining additional vehicles.

Managing Window Focus While Debugging A Graphical User Interface Program

US Patent:
2014017, Jun 19, 2014
Filed:
Dec 18, 2012
Appl. No.:
13/717768
Inventors:
- Armonk NY, US
James I. Martineau - Somerville MA, US
Lorelei M. McCollum - Somerville MA, US
Michael S. McCowan - Somerville MA, US
Assignee:
INTERNATIONAL BUSINESS MACHINES CORPORATION - Armonk NY
International Classification:
G06F 11/36
US Classification:
717125
Abstract:
An embodiment of the present invention utilizes the abilities of an operating system to manage the window focus while debugging a graphical user interface program. In an example, a debugger program intercepts a breakpoint in the code of a graphical user interface computer program undergoing automated testing by a separate computer program. The debugger program instructs the operating system to save states of the window focus. Responsive to determining the breakpoint condition has ended, the debugger program instructs the operating system to restore saved states of the window that had focus prior to the breakpoint condition. Another embodiment of the present invention arranges similar window focus management where an operating system on its own is unable to save and restore states of the window that had focus prior to the breakpoint condition.
